TN HJR0773

A RESOLUTION to honor and congratulate Dr. Hans Ballew on his selection as the 2025-2026 Sevier County School System Supervisor of the Year.

Passed House Andrew Farmer (R)
Plain English Summary

The bill is a resolution that honors Dr. Hans Ballew for being named the Supervisor of the Year for the Sevier County School System for the years 2025-2026. It recognizes his contributions to education and leadership within the school system. The resolution has been sponsored by Representative Andrew Farmer and has successfully passed.

The bill HJR0773 is a resolution honoring Dr. Hans Ballew as the Sevier County School System Supervisor of the Year, which does not involve any regulatory or financial implications that would directly affect the sponsor, Andrew Farmer. His personal financial interests primarily lie in the legal field, specifically through his ownership of law firms and title companies. Since the bill is purely a recognition of an individual and does not propose any changes to laws or funding that could impact his businesses, there is no evident conflict of interest. The focus on education in this resolution does not intersect with Farmer's legal practice or business operations, which are centered around litigation and title services.
